DESSERTS & BREADS

COCONUTCAKE

1 W/z-ounce package yellow cake mix

1 3Sounce package coconut- flavored instant pudding mix

4 eggs

1 cup water l/4 cup oil

1 12-ounce jar strawberry or raspberry preserves

2 4%ounce containers dessert topping thawed

1% cups flaked coconut

1.Combine cake mix, pudding mix, eggs, water and oil in a large bowl of an electric mixer and beat at medium speed with mixer for 4 mrnutes. Pour batter into a well-greased 10 to 12-cup tube pan. Microwave, uncovered at MEDIUM for 15 to 20 minutes, or until there is no uncooked batter remaining near the bottom of the pan and the cake has begun to pull away from the sides of the pan. Let stand, covered, for 15 minutes. Loosen edges, invert onto a serving plate. Cover and let stand until cool.

2.Split cake horizontally into 3 layers, spread with preserves and reassemble. Frost with dessert topping and sprinkle with coconut. Store, covered, in the refrigerator until serving time.

Makes 1 cake

PINEAPPLE MUFFINS

1 O-ounce can crushed pineapple, well drained

‘14cup syrup reserved

%cup packed dark brown sugar 3 tablespoons butter or margarine

1 egg

1 cup flour

VZcup chopped pecans or walnuts 1 teaspoon baking powder ‘12teaspoon salt

1.In a 11/z-quart mixing bowl, cream together drained pineapple, brown sugar, and butter. Beat in egg and reserved syrup. Add flour, nuts, baking powder and salt. Stir only until dry ingredients are moistened. Turn batter into 6 to B-ounce custard cups lined with cupcake papers.

2.Arrange 4 custard cups on a round baking tray. Microwave, uncovered at HIGH for 4% to 6% minutes. Repeat procedure with remaining 4 custard cups. Let muffins stand 5 minutes before serving.

Makes 8 muffins

APRICOT WALNUT BREAD

%cup milk ‘12cup water

1 cup chopped dried apricots grated peel of 1 orange

V4 cup packed dark brown sugar

1 egg, lightly beaten

3 tablespoons oil

%cup chopped walnuts

1% cups flour

1 teaspoon baking powder

‘14teaspoon ground nutmeg or mace ‘12teaspoon salt

1.Combine milk, water, dried apricots, and orange peel in a 2-quart glass bowl. Microwave, uncovered, at HIGH for 2 to 3% minutes, or until mixture boils, stirring once.

2.Add brown sugar, egg, and oil to fruit mixture, beating to blend well. Stir in remaining ingredients. Pour batter into a greased loaf dish. Do not cover.

3.Set microwave oven at MEDIUM 10 minutes and then HIGH for 3 minutes. If necessary, microwave at HIGH an additional 3% to 8 minutes to complete cooking, rotating once. Let loaf stand 10 minutes before removing from dish. Let stand an additional 5 minutes before serving.

Makes 1 loaf.
